Overview of Gene Research
Ppara, also known as pe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or alpha, is a ligand-activated transcription factor that serves as a key mediator of lipid metabolism and metabolic stress in the liver [1]. It is involved in multiple pathways, such as regulating fatty acid transport and catabolism, and is crucial for maintaining lipid homeostasis [2]. Genetic models, especially KO/CKO mouse models, have been valuable in studying its functions.
In Cbfa2t3 -/- mice, insulin resistance increased compared to Cbfa2t3+/+ mice, and lipid droplet and lipid accumulation occurred in the liver during fasting, indicating that hepatic CBFA2T3, a PPARA -sensitive gene, may modulate metabolic stress in mouse liver [1]. Intestine-specific Ppara disruption in mice fed a high-fat diet decreased obesity-associated metabolic disorders and non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), suggesting that intestinal PPARα signaling promotes NASH progression through regulating dietary fatty acid uptake [2].
In conclusion, Ppara is essential for lipid metabolism and metabolic stress regulation. Studies using KO/CKO mouse models have revealed its significant roles in diseases like insulin resistance-related lipid metabolism disorders and NASH, providing valuable insights into understanding disease mechanisms and potential therapeutic targets.
